thero10
03.07.2022 15:26

Нужна с написанием алгоритма.


Нужна с написанием алгоритма.

Нажмите на рекламу ниже и сразу увидите ответ
Популярные вопросы:
Ответ:
zaporozkayaoks
07.06.2023 18:56
Наполняем девятилитровое ведро. В пятилитровом теперь - 0 л, в девятилитровом - 9.
Переливаем в пятилитровое. В пятилитровом теперь - 5 л, в девятилитровом - 4.
Опустошаем пятилитровое В пятилитровом теперь - 0 л, в девятилитровом - 4.
Переливаем из девятилитрового в пятилитровое. В пятилитровом теперь - 4 л, в девятилитровом - 0.
Наполняем девятилитровое. В пятилитровом теперь - 5 л, в девятилитровом - 8.
Опустошаем пятилитровое ведро. В пятилитровом теперь - 0 л, в девятилитровом - 8.
Переливаем из девятилитрового в пятилитровое ведро. В пятилитровом теперь - 5 л, в девятилитровом - 3.
Опустошаем пятилитровое. Остается во втором ведре ровно 3 литра.
0,0(0 оценок)
Ответ:
Annna987
08.01.2021 17:23
Суть нужного алгоритма в следующем:
Заводим массив из 21 члена. Первый член будет соответствовать первой ступени. Приравняем его значение к единицы. Таким образом для каждой ступени будем считать количество вариантов на неё попадания. Для каждой ступени это будет суммой предыдущих двух членов. 
То есть a[0]=1, тогда:
a[1]=1 //на первую ступень можно попасть одним
a[2]=1+1=2 //на вторую ступень двумя - с нулевой и с первой
a[3]=2+1=3 //на третью ступень можно попасть либо с первой, либо со второй, на которую в свою очередь можно попасть двумя
a[4]=3+2=5
a[5]=5+3=8
и так далее

Заметим, что это последовательность Фибоначчи. Тогда решением будет 21-й член этой прогрессии. Можно посчитать вручную, либо через программу. ответ 10 946.
0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ота